Ile-Ife (Osun) – An Ile-Ife Customary Court in Osun on Thursday dissolved the 11-year-old marriage between Olatoyosi Adeniji and her husband, Adewumi, over threat to life.
The President of the Court, Alhaji Ganiyu Awoyera, in his judgment, dissolved the marriage and ordered that there would be no refund of dowry.
Awoyera awarded custody of two out of the three children the couple had to Olatoyosi as their first born, who is deaf and dumb, was at a welfare home operated by the Osun State Government.
He appealed to Olatoyosi to always take the children to government hospitals, whenever they fell sick.
Awoyera also ordered that the husband should pay N30, 000 per month for the upkeep of the children and be fully responsible for their education.
He urged both parties to give peace a chance and abstain from all forms of trouble.
Olatoyosi had on Nov. 2 urged the court to dissolve her marriage over lack of care, threat to life and desertion since 2012.

She said that when she could not cope with being abandoned, she then went into another marriage in 2014.
The defendant agreed with the dissolution. He said that his wife always demanded for huge amounts of money which he did not have. (NAN)
